Sash weights
Sash weights are counterweights which work with small pulleys and cables to offset the weight of windows to allow it to open and close without a hit instead of slamming. Blacksmiths will not be too concerned about them since they're cast iron and cannot be forged. They can be sold at scrap yards for as just $0.10 per lb.
It is essential to pay attention to the details when choosing the right sash for your windows. Accurate measurements are crucial because a lapse in measurement could result in a window which is not properly balanced or can't be opened. There are many ways to avoid the problem by using an electronic scale or a tape measure that is calibrated.
It is important to take into account the width and height of the window when putting in the sashweight. A tall, wide window will require a stronger counterweight than a smaller and shorter window. Additionally the sash weight needs to be placed in the pocket. The pocket for weights must be properly sized and placed so that the sash can be capable of passing through without becoming stuck or hitting the counterweight.
Regular maintenance can avoid problems like frayed cords or misaligned pulleys. It is also recommended that sash weight systems be inspected every year at a minimum to spot any issues before they become serious. By regularly maintaining the sash weight system homeowners can enjoy years of trouble-free operation and energy efficiency.
Sash weights are safer than lead, and can be used with a variety of windows with sash. In addition the sash weights made of steel are available in various sizes and weights, making them an ideal choice for any window.
It is possible to install the sash weights yourself, but it's a good idea to consult an expert to ensure the task is done properly. A professional will have the tools and equipment needed and safety equipment to safeguard them from injuries or damage. A professional will also know how to determine the right sash weight for your windows and offer recommendations based on particular requirements.
Installation
The hinges on windows are crucial for the proper opening and closing of windows. They can also impact the structural integrity of windows and airflow as well as energy efficiency. Therefore, it's crucial to find and fix hinge issues before they become more serious. This will extend the life of your windows and will make them more energy efficient.
It is essential to follow the guidelines of the manufacturer when installing new hinges. This will ensure a correct installation of the new hinges and smooth operation of the window. A poor installation could result in gaps between the window frame and sash, which could result in drafts or loss of energy. Also, improperly fixed or aligned hinges may be difficult to open and close the window sash.
The proper hinge type for casement windows is essential. There are many different hinge types, each with its own specifications and requirements. Using the wrong hinge type could result in issues, such as difficulties opening and closing the window sash, inadequate ventilation, and safety hazards. The handle position is a simple way to identify the correct hinge type. Hinges that have a handle that is fixed to the bottom are side-hung, and those with a handle at the top are top hung.
It is possible to replace your old hinges if they are damaged, rusted or loose. A defective hinge for your window can ruin the entire mechanism, affecting the performance and efficiency of the. Replacing the hinges on your windows can be a fairly simple DIY task. These tips will help you complete the project and return your windows back to their original state of operation.
Before you finish the project, it is essential to conduct an inspection to make sure that the hinges are properly installed and the window is operating smoothly. Also, ensure that you eliminate any garbage and tidy up the area. Keep track of the installation. This includes the type and size of window hinges that you employed, any modifications or reinforcements added, and the date of the installation. These records are helpful for warranty purposes and as a future references.
